Rated 4 out of 5 stars

Love them, returning customer

Im really surprised by people experiences on here. I got my first set or headphones just before Covid hit us, prior to that i was in the gym regularly but from this point I started running. They were an absolute ray of sunshine, I managed to get good distances and the charge lasted a half marathon so I was happy, however a rattling noise started. I contacted customer services and a replacement was sent out with no issues at all, this new pair I have had for years and still no issues however I have been very tempted by the swimming version. I have just got them, the sound quality is brilliant as it was for the old pair and im just uploading some music as the swimming function I believe can only be used with the MP3 function. These are great, when out running, you can still hear the world around to be careful and in the gym, I put ear plugs in and im in my own little world, ignoring the rubbish gym music and irritating chatters who love to talk as loud as they can. Access to good music whilst training 100% helps me get to my goals so im happy. 4 stars only because the charger for the swimmer version is different to the older version, which now means I have to buy spares, would have been a 5 star if they just include 2 chargers.

Warranty not honoured

Bought a brand new & unused (still sealed) pair of Aeropex AS800 off of an eBay shop in May 2021 and I registered them right away, in order to validate the 2 year manufacturer warranty.

They failed to work in March 2022, but not a problem (or so I thought) they’re covered by a 2yr warranty from the manufacturer.

I sent in the report using their website, with screen grab of my warranty registration.


I was informed that because I hadn’t bought them from an authorised seller (as listed on their website) that they wouldn’t honour the warranty.

I did challenge this but got nowhere.



Surely, the warranty is to do with the quality of manufacture, and wherever you buy from it won’t alter the quality control etc. when they’re manufactured?

I also think it is unreasonable to expect anyone to trawl a manufacturers website before purchase to see if they’re buying from the right place.

Having previously had this issue, why don’t Aftershokz raise this at the time of registering the warranty, so you can return the item if needs be (it should be made clear on the packaging!)

Some reservations but generally a great experience

I have some sympathy with the negative reviews for AfterShokz on this platform. The product itself is produced in China, and the often questionable standard of English on their website suggests that there may not be any dedicated customer support based in the UK. There certainly isn't a phone number available. Moreover, my first set of AfterShokz Air headphones only lasted six months before one of the rubber pads fell off. These pads apparently cannot just be put back on - a design flaw which clearly undermines the durability of the product.

Despite all that, my own experience with Aftershokz customer service was outstanding. I first alerted them to the problem via email on a Sunday evening, received my first reply at 7am the following morning, and have just now received a replacement set of headphones (which work perfectly) on Thursday. All they needed was the warranty number and proof of purchase, which I had already provided by registering the product online. I am very impressed by the promptness of the service, which ensured I was only out of action for three days.

The headphones themselves are not of the best build quality, as seen above from the rubber pad falling off. And you shouldn't buy them if you are after really great audio quality. However, I have found them to be an indispensable aid to my commute: indeed, they have helped me get through my considerable podcast backlog while cycling to work! Most importantly, I feel safe wearing them on my bike, which would certainly not be the case with ordinary in-ear/on-ear headphones which block out ambient noise from traffic and pedestrians. AfterShokz headphones are entirely workable and suitable for their purpose, and while their cost may be quite steep, in my view it is worth it in order to stay safe on the roads.

Based purely on my own experience, and despite some reservations, I would certainly recommend this product.
